Profumo

Perfume

Typical olfactory profile designed by the ferrous and Mediterranean lava features of bramble fruit, Mediterranean scrub, aromatic herbs and dried flowers. Fine outline of nutmeg and coffee powder.

Colore

Color

Ruby with slight transparencies and garnet flashes.

Gusto

Taste

The taste is elegantly dressed with velvety tannic texture, balanced fresh glyceric composition and long, tasty trail. Long persistence in the finish consistent with varietal and territorial returns.

Producer
Graci
From this winery
  • Start up year: 2004
  • Oenologist: Alberto Aiello Graci, Emiliano Falsini
  • Bottles produced: 85.000
  • Hectares: 30
Alberto Aiello Graci is a young man of 35 who decided to change his life after studying economics and a job in Milan. He chose to return to Sicily and start a new profession, that of wine grower. For almost 2 years now, his younger sister, Elena, has been working alongside him with the same great dedication and passion. Ever since he embarked on this new adventure, Alberto has always had clear ideas: he has taken over vineyards of resplendent beauty, vines cultivated using the alberello system that time, climate and the work of winegrowers have changed in shape.
Grapes and volcano, these are the wines of Graci, unique interpreters of an extraordinary terroir. The winery is an old and majestic palmento skilfully restored by Alberto. Here, one part is occupied by the production structure, while another part, with cross vaults, still houses the old barrels and tools for wine production.

Origin Castiglione di Sicilia (Catania).
Soil composition Volcanic, sandy and sandy loam, rich in the skeleton. It is a soil rich in iron and nitrogen with a neutral pH.
Plants per hectare 6,000 0,000.
Yield per hectare 4,000 kg/hectare.
Harvest Last week of October.
Wine making Traditional fermentation in red without using selected yeasts and controlling temperature in truncated cone oak vats. Maceration on the skins for 30 to 90 days.
Aging 24 months in large oak vats with spontaneous malolactic fermentation followed by 6 months in the bottle.
